19 However, changes in MHQ exhibited an expected trend where individuals reporting more than 70% overall satisfaction demonstrated larger improvements in MHQ during PNE compared to those reporting less than 70% overall satisfaction (46.6% vs 23.3%), though this result did not reach statistical significance ( p = 0.141).
